LEVELS OF COACHING CAPACITY

Companies seeking to develop coaching excellence in a deliberate fashion find it helpful to invest in different levels of coaching capacity. Such an approach makes financial sense by ensuring a wise allocation of resources. It also provides a clear developmental path for people committed to enhancing their coaching skills in a way that is appropriate for their level of responsibility.

  • Level 1: Baseline competence in speaking and listening as a coach, making grounded assessments, and providing spontaneous coaching. People develop this competence through one of our 9-month programs.
  • Level 2: Intermediate coaching competence that includes Level 1 skills and the capacity to develop people over time via custom-designed programs. People develop this competence through the Professional Coaching Course (PCC), offered through the Integral Coach Training branch of New Ventures West or as an in-house program.
  • Level 3: The capacity to serve as an organizational champion for coaching. People at this level advise others about pursuing coaching or coach training and make referrals to internal or external coaches. They possess Level 2 skills coupled with organizational acumen and competence at matching people with coaches. They develop this competence through "shadow matching" with one of our senior coaches.
  • Level 4: The capacity to lead in-house coaching programs like Manager as Integral Coach. People at this level have developed Level 3 skills and, through additional training and coaching, have been licensed to lead in-house programs.
